Top Suspension Upgrades for the Dodge Challenger Redeye

When considering suspension upgrades, several options can dramatically improve the handling characteristics of the Challenger Redeye.

1. Coilover Kits

Coilover kits allow for adjustable ride height and damping settings, providing the flexibility needed for both street and track performance. Brands like KW and BC Racing offer high-quality options.

2. Sway Bars

Upgrading to performance sway bars reduces body roll during cornering, enhancing stability. Look for adjustable sway bars from manufacturers like Eibach or Whiteline.

3. Strut Tower Braces

Strut tower braces increase chassis rigidity, improving steering response and handling. They are a simple yet effective upgrade for the Redeye.

Essential Braking Upgrades for the Dodge Challenger Redeye

Braking performance is just as critical as suspension upgrades. Here are some of the best braking enhancements available for the Challenger Redeye.

1. Upgraded Brake Pads

High-performance brake pads improve stopping power and reduce fade during aggressive driving. Brands like Hawk and EBC offer excellent options specifically designed for muscle cars.

2. Performance Brake Rotors

Swapping out stock rotors for slotted or drilled performance rotors can enhance heat dissipation and improve braking performance. Consider options from Brembo or StopTech.

3. Braided Brake Lines

Upgrading to braided stainless steel brake lines provides a firmer pedal feel and reduces brake line expansion under pressure, leading to more consistent braking performance.

Combining Suspension and Braking Upgrades

For the best results, it’s essential to combine both suspension and braking upgrades. This holistic approach ensures that the vehicle can handle the increased performance without compromising safety.

Balanced Upgrades

When selecting upgrades, consider how they will work together. For example, stiffer suspension may require more aggressive braking components to maintain balance and control.

Professional Installation

While many upgrades can be installed at home, professional installation is recommended for complex modifications. This ensures that all components are correctly aligned and functioning optimally.
